Address

KDkbwH84VUUuQxok11joeKGd8HNp2X8FE4

0 KUMA

Confirmed
Total Received172.76636600 KUMA
Total Sent172.76636600 KUMA
Final Balance0 KUMA
No. Transactions2

Transactions

KDkbwH84VUUuQxok11joeKGd8HNp2X8FE4172.76636600 KUMA
 
 
KDkbwH84VUUuQxok11joeKGd8HNp2X8FE4172.76636600 KUMA